Rumor Has It That Slayder Has a New Destination
After a period of competing in VCS, around the middle of the 2024 season, Slayder transitioned to play in the Arabian League – a tournament belonging to EMEA (the second tier of the LEC region) for the team Nigma Galaxy. However, his time with the Saudi Arabian team was quite short, and recently, information has emerged that Slayder has a new destination.

Accordingly, Slayder’s new team is named Dark Passage – a team from Turkey that also competes in the EMEA league of the European region. However, at this moment, this is just a rumor from LEC transfer insiders. Neither Dark Passage nor Slayder has made any announcements or confirmations yet.

The Team That Slayder May Join Is Far From Ordinary
Although it only competes in the second tier of Europe and is not particularly well-known worldwide, DP should not be underestimated. This is one of the oldest teams in the League of Legends scene, having been established since 2012. And while it cannot participate in the LEC, this team remains a very strong force in the TCL.
More importantly, DP has been the former team of several well-known European League of Legends stars familiar to the audience. Notable names include Caps, Humanoid, BrokenBlade, and Bwipo. It can be said that DP is associated with many of the top LEC superstars in the world today.
